- What is this tool?
- Mathematica is a computational software platform for symbolic and numerical mathematics, data visualization, and programming.
- How much does it cost?
- Mathematica offers a free trial; full licenses vary by user type and can be purchased from Wolfram Research.
- Does it have a free plan?
- Mathematica provides a free trial but does not have a permanent free tier.
- What integrations does it support?
- Mathematica integrates with Wolfram Cloud and supports data import/export but has limited third-party SaaS integrations.
- Who is it best for?
- It is best for researchers, engineers, and educators needing advanced computational and visualization tools.
- What is this tool?
- FourKites provides real-time visibility for logistics and supply chain management.
- How much does it cost?
- Pricing is enterprise-based and tailored for large organizations.
- Does it have a free plan?
- No, FourKites does not offer a free plan.
- What integrations does it support?
- Integrations are available with various logistics platforms.
- Who is it best for?
- Best suited for large enterprises in logistics and supply chain.
